hello guys,
I am a beginner in using matlab, and I have a case which I can't solve it, can anyone help?
I have a 7 x 2 input matrix, as I demonstrated below
A = [1 100
2 110
3 120
4 130
5 140
6 150
7 160]
and then i have a value of 125. from that value i want i get a new matrix that is
B = [3 120
4 130]
Could someone help me please?

q = 125;
idx = interp1(A(:,2), (1:size(A,1)).', q);
B = A(floor(idx):ceil(idx), :);
This relies upon the entries in the second column being monotonic (all increasing or all decreasing.)

q = 125;
[~,inx] = mink(abs(A(:,2) - q),2);
B = A(inx,:);
or for old MATLAB
q = 125;
[~,inx] = sort(abs(A(:,2) - 125));
B = A(inx(1:2),:);
